Setting the BIOS password - admin password unknown - Dell T5810/T5820

Resets the passwords for the BIOS settings when the admin password is not known.

important: Disconnect the power cord from the computer and allow the internal components to cool before doing these steps.
  • notice
  • Potential component damage
  • Electrostatic discharge (ESD) can cause permanent damage to electronic components.
  • Observe the following ESD precautions:
    • Work on a static-free mat.
    • Wear a static strap to ensure that any accumulated electrostatic charge is discharged from your body to the ground.
    • Create a common ground for the equipment being worked on by connecting the static-free mat, static strap, and peripheral units to that piece of equipment.

Procedure

  1. Shut down the operating system.
  2. Power off the workstation and external devices.
  3. Do Removing the host computer or Removing the host computer - Dell T5820.
  4. Remove the side cover.

    Figure 1. Dell T5810

    Figure 2. Dell T5820

  5. Locate the password header and jumper. The password jumper is labeled PSWD.

    Figure 3. Password jumper location - T5810

    Figure 4. Password jumper location - T5820

  6. Make sure the power cord is disconnected from the host computer.
  7. Remove the password jumper.
    note: The password jumper is colored so it can be easily identified.
  8. Reconnect all components and the power to the workstation.
  9. Install the side cover.
    1. Hold and align the bottom of the side cover to the chassis.
    2. Make sure the hook on the bottom of the side cover snaps into the notch on the system.
    3. Press the system cover until it clicks into place.
      note: The system will not power on without the side cover. Also, the system will shut down if the side cover is removed while the system is on.
  10. Power on the workstation until video appears on the monitor.
  11. Shut down the workstation.
  12. Remove the side cover.
  13. Install the password jumper. This will clear the passwords.
  14. Install the side cover.
  15. Do Installing the host computer or Installing the host computer - Dell T5820.
  16. Power on the computer. The computer will not require any passwords after this reset; both System and Admin passwords will be erased.
